It spoke to her. He was right. She hadn’t liked the fancy orchestra. She felt like they were a bit stiff, like when her father used to select the music. Aria gave a little chuckle, walking past him to pick up the violin before sitting down next to him to play alongside him.

He watched her as she focused on reading the music to keep up with him. Troy played the piano to amuse people all the time. He’d never had someone play an instrument with him though, for him. Their eyes met as the song ended.

“I liked that,” she confessed.

He smiled.

“I should hope so. I wrote it.”

“Show off.”

He chuckled for perhaps the first time in her presence. How had he never done that in front of her before? How had she known him this long without hearing his amazing laugh?

“You play beautifully. It’s not every day I meet with a woman who plays, well, anything.”
